Trimethylaluminum (TMA) for High Purity Application is a chemical compound with the formula (CH3)3Al. It is a colorless, volatile, and highly reactive liquid that is widely used in various industrial processes. As a high purity grade, this product is specifically designed for applications that require a high level of purity to ensure optimal performance and safety. TMA is commonly used as a catalyst in the production of olefins and as a reagent in the synthesis of various organic compounds. Its high purity ensures minimal impurities, which is crucial for maintaining the quality and efficiency of the reactions it is involved in. Additionally, high purity TMA is essential in semiconductor manufacturing, where it is used in the deposition of aluminum films and as a doping agent. The stringent purity requirements in these applications necessitate a meticulous manufacturing process to ensure the product's consistency and reliability.
